Notlar This file contains correspondence regarding the murder of a man and woman on property in Fao [The Al Faw Peninsula in Iraq] owned by Shaikh Mubārak Āl Ṣabāḥ, the ruler of Kuwait.Mulla Muhammad (also written as Moola Mahomet in the file), Shaikh Mubārak 's agent in Fao, is reported to have found the dead bodies of a man and a woman killed by Turkish soldiers. Muhammad's testimony is contained on folio 30. The dead man is identified as being of Persian origin and named Hamid bin Aleywah, his wife is said to have been pregnant at the time of the killing. Conflicting accounts of events are discussed by British officials and Muhammad is accused by the Ottoman authorities of having committed the murders himself (this accusation is eventually ruled out by the British).The file also contains broader discussions concerning the status of Shaikh Mubārak's estates in Fao and his relationship with the Ottoman authorities and the British. | 1 volume (80 folios) | File is arranged in chronological order, from earliest at beginning of the file to most recent at end.An index of topics discussed in the file is contained on folio 2. | Condition: A bound correspondence volume.Foliation: The file's foliation sequence commences at the front cover and terminates at the back cover; these numbers are written in pencil, are circled, and can be found in the top right corner of the recto side of each folio. An inconsistent pagination sequence is also present in the volume between ff. 4-50; these numbers are written in blue crayon, and can be found in the top left or right corners of the verso and recto sides of each folio. | more | less
